Sunny Leone denied permission to perform at Kerala University

The Vice Chancellor of Kerala University has reportedly denied permission for Sunny Leone’s performance. The event is scheduled to take place on in July 5.

Kerala University Vice Chancellor Dr Mohanan Kunnumal has stated that authorities have prohibited performance by outside bands and artists inside the campuses of the affiliated colleges abd institutes.

He recalled how last year, ahead of singer Nikhita Gandhi’s performance in school of engineering of the Cochin University of Science and Technology, there was a massive stampede that resulted in the death of four students and injuries to sixty if them, reports free press journal.

The artist’s also charge a hefty fee and since students cannot afford it they resort to crowd funding, which is also not allowed inside the university campus, adds the report.
